The story revolves around and Jace Covington . Four years before the book begins, Dylan was Jace's first friend, first crush, and first kiss. Following a scandalous, catastrophic family incident, Dylan was forced to leave town, abruptly breaking all contact.

The story follows Dylan , a girl from the wrong side of the tracks who gets a scholarship to the prestigious and cruel Royal Hearts Academy. The "prince" of the school is Jace Covington —a wealthy, handsome, and merciless bully. Jace and his friends make Dylan’s life a living hell, but underneath the cruelty lies a tangled history and a powerful, toxic attraction. The book is known for its angst, steamy scenes, and emotional twists.

Yes, Cruel Prince focuses on Jace and Dylan and has a complete, satisfying ending. However, it is the first book in the Royal Hearts Academy series, which follows other characters from the same world in subsequent books.

When a reader finds this book via a VK pirate link, they bypass the very content warnings that responsible authors and publishers embed in the front matter. The VK version is often a raw, unformatted file stripped of author’s notes, trigger lists, and copyright pages. This creates a dangerous irony: readers seeking dark, edgy content may inadvertently consume it without the ethical scaffolding that professional publishing provides. Cruel Prince Ashley Jade Vk
